HP Ireland invests in employee health programme

HP Ireland is offering on-site breast examination and risk assessment to 4,500 of its employees and their families as part of its new global wellness initiative.

It has joined forces with the Mater Private Hospital and Aviva Health Insurance to launch the programme called ‘The Power of Pink’, which it says is the first of its scale in Ireland.

As part of the programme, HP employees and their families will be eligible to be assessed by a team of experts from the Mater Private Specialist Breast Centre by the end of October. Additional support and advice will be made available throughout the process for any employee who may be affected by the disease.

The Power of Pink initiative focuses on early detection and diagnosis of breast cancer. HP has invested in this global employee health programme working with Aviva, a team of physicians and breast care nurses who will carry out the assessments on site at HP’s offices in Dublin, Galway and Kildare from mid-September. Lunchtime seminars will also take place to educate employees on cancer prevention.

Speaking at the event, Dr Gormlaith Hargaden, Consultant Radiologist specialising in breast cancer with the Mater Private Hospital, described the Power of Pink as a “forward-thinking initiative”.
